Cybercrime is rising, reaching record highs in 2024. According to the FBI’s IC3 report, total losses exceeded $16 billion. With investment fraud and BEC scams at the forefront, the message is clear: the real estate sector remains a lucrative target for cybercriminals. At CertifID, we take this threat seriously and provide a secure platform that verifies the identities of parties involved in transactions, authenticates wire transfer instructions, and detects potential fraud attempts.
